Placards calling for action displayed during Chakwera’s State of the Nation Address

President Lazarus Chakwera is delivering his State of the Nation Address (SONA) in Parliament today, but the event was marred by the display of placards by opposition members.

As the President entered the House, some opposition members held up placards with various messages urging him to take action on important issues affecting the country. Some of the messages were critical of the President’s leadership, while others called for urgent action to address challenges faced by the country.

The messages on the placards read, “Hire the youth not retirees,” “Create jobs not thieving empire,” “Where is the President,” “Malawi has no leadership,” “Malawi lost under Chakwera,” “Malawi is a crime scene,” “We are tired of your words Chakwera,” “We need action,” and “No drugs in hospitals.”
